    Primary Responsibilities:
    To assist the Head Speech Coach in the selection instruction training and conditioning of all students assigned to the Assistant Coach by the Head Coach.


    Qualification Requirements
    To perform this job successfully an individual must be able to perform each essential function satisfactorily. The
    requ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ge skill and/or ability required. Reasonable
    acc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

    Essential Functions

    • Coordinates manages and facilitates school based youth sports and activity programs.
    • Provides for the health safety and well-being of team members.
    • Promotes positive communication between coaches activity staffparents students and outside agencies.
    • Integrates goals and standards of Columbia Heights schools into the sport programs and activity events.
    • Completes continuing education courses meetings and events.
    • Communicates and implements the head coaches and activity staffs vision for the program.


    Education and Experience
    High school diploma or GED and moderate experience working in a coaching capacity or equivalent combination of
    education and experience.
